Member: 1125708 Status: Offline Thanks Meter: 5 | Did it by myself OK, I just fixed the problem, so for anybody who will have the same problem, I will write, what I've done. I used the format method in MTK-Tool whith manual settings: Beginn-Address: 0x00E00000 Format-Length: 0x00200000 After I formatted the phone with this settings, I used Spiderman Vers. 2.55 and flashed the phone with the firmware, I'd like to use, in this case the one with german language files! And voila, phone still is alive again and german language is now availible for me. Great job, brother Slyme |

Member: 1125708 Status: Offline Thanks Meter: 5 | I fixed the problems by the way I wroted on 4 of 5 Sciphone i9+++ with firmware version TG01_V1.1.0 08A Step 1 : Use the MTK-Tool (newest Version), you will find it here in the forum Step 2 : Open MTK, set Baud Rate under Options to 460800, select your COM-Port, click on Format Step 3 : In the new window that will open choose Option "Manual Format FAT" and use as Begin Address: 0x00E00000 and Format Length: 0x00200000 Step 4 : Click on OK (note that there is no battery in your phone until now), put in your battery and power on your phone, using the power on button for 1-2 sec. Step 5: If all settings are good and your flash-cable will work, your phone will be formated very soon Step 6: After formating the phone connect to Spiderman (note that you should use one of the latest versions, those which can decryt firmware files) Step 7: Select COM-Port, set Baud Rate, select NOR-Flash, uncheck V3.840.00 and click on Flash (select firmware-file) Step 8: If flash file and all settings are OK, your new firmware will be installed in a few minutes Step 9: If flash failed, try a lower Baud Rate Step 10: Your done!!! I only have a problem with one of my phones, there won't this solution work, I will get a dead phone after installing the firmware as I described in my first post. When I flash back to original firmware, the phone will work again, but not with the firmware I wish to use. I don't know what's the problem with this phone, cause the others have exactly same firmware and are from the same manufactor and there it will work! Hope this post is useful for somebody, maybe someone knows a solution for the phone on which the flash failed! |
